Transaction c6f770d29e1978bc62bd4f5710f9fb99cd86b46aa8ae6430155121e520eb17ed
1 Input
1 Output
-
c6f770d29e1978bc62bd4f5710f9fb99cd86b46aa8ae6430155121e520eb17ed:0
- value
- 391886
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d89b1c3b46ba08ddad88569e7dcf3f9805d8356 OP_EQUAL
- address
- 3D8oLhMr6FN34ouWN9TBGKYSD8h4ydGxub